Counselling vs. Psychotherapy
While both are talking therapies, they serve different needs:
-
Counselling is often sought for a specific problem you're facing in your life, usually over a shorter term.
-
Psychotherapy is sought when your life itself has become the problem, exploring deeper, long-standing patterns.
